Top of the world

Returning for our second visit and you never get bored of the stunning scenery and peaceful surroundings. Easy to find along a typically narrow Anglesey road with easy access onto the field, there are two fields here, one exclusively for us CMC members, each well maintained grass pitch benefits from EHU your own personal fresh water tap and grey waste drainage, basically a super pitch, then the adjoining field which can accommodate up to 10 units for none club members or overflow separated by a 4ft high wire fence in an L shape affair, the field has a slight slope but John is always on hand on arrival to help you pitch up with blocks provided, John and his wife work hard to ensure your welcome and stay is bob on. Toilet and shower facilities & a fully equipped games room in an old barn are available to guests however we use our own caravan facilities but John ensures they are kept clean daily. There’s a large adjacent field to exercise the pooch on & a paddock with horses so bring a carrot or two. This site is exposed to the elements so if your bringing the awning bring your storm ties but the pay off is the most incredible feeling of being on top of the world, 360o views from Snowdonia to the Irish Sea with the incredible breathtaking Anglesey countryside in between, at one point I could hear nothing but the wind in my ears and the sound of nature. Fully recommend this dog friendly site to families or couples, johns dog Jess often roams about the vans, slightly deaf and blind but simply too cute not to give a good hug & a doggy great to. If you have never been to Anglesey, come, it’s simply stunning with its own micro climate, incredible beaches and unspoilt coves, great dining experiences and pubs, Beaumaris and Red Wharf Bay is not too far and a great day out. Whether your into chilling with a good book and a bottle of something naughty or an active holiday with water sports galore, Anglesey has something for everyone. Enjoy!
